Assistant Field Technician
The Kensington Conservancy is a local land trust that protects almost 1,200 acres of ecologically sensitive land in the St. Joseph Channel area. We are looking to hire up to two summer employees to assist with field work, our environmental education programs, and related tasks.

Duties and Responsibilities
- monitor nature preserves for disturbances and general ecological health
- collect data on the presence of flora and fauna species
- basic trail maintenance
- conduct guided tours
- conduct educational programs within the local community, especially for youth
Qualifications and Skills Required
- completed, or currently completing, a diploma or degree in a field related to natural resources
- identification of local flora and fauna species, including invasive species
- knowledge of local ecosystems and how they function
- experience working outdoors in all weather conditions
- exceptional outdoor navigation skills
- the ability to work both independently and as a team
- experience working with youth
Candidate Eligibility
- must be a youth between the ages of 15 and 30 and a permanent resident of Canada
- available for evening and weekend work
